Carol Jean Tillman September 6 2013. Hyperpigmentation occurs when the skin has too much pigmentation resulting in black dog skin spots. In addition to skin changes other body changes such as muscle wasting may occur.
Near the dogs privates you may also notice black spots if the dog is infected with the yeast fungus. A very common cause of dark pigmentation in the skin is referred to as lichenification where the black patches are caused by chronic irritation. Or it can happen when there is an interruption to the stages of hair growth.
